MCP: various work on the button binding GUI
[ardour.git] / libs / surfaces / mackie / wscript
index 9aac5ce811e1de55eb6e796c9069dbb9d156735a..5f0bb1aa2d6454675cc602a7f7a46f61cd7914ec 100644 (file)
@@ -23,15 +23,19 @@ def build(bld):
     obj.source = '''
             button.cc
             controls.cc
+            device_info.cc
+            device_profile.cc
             fader.cc
             gui.cc
             interface.cc
+            jog.cc
+            led.cc
             mackie_control_protocol.cc
             mackie_jog_wheel.cc
-            mackie_midi_builder.cc
             mcp_buttons.cc
             meter.cc
             midi_byte_array.cc
+            pot.cc
             strip.cc
             surface.cc
             surface_port.cc
@@ -39,7 +43,8 @@ def build(bld):
     '''
     obj.export_includes = ['./mackie']
     obj.cxxflags     = '-DPACKAGE="ardour_mackie"'
-    obj.includes     = ['.', './mackie']
+    # need ../libs because some GTK2 header files require stuff there
+    obj.includes     = ['.', '../libs']
     obj.name         = 'libardour_mcp'
     obj.target       = 'ardour_mcp'
     obj.uselib       = 'GTKMM'